The Bar Fight

Title: The Bar Fight
Pairing/Warning/Rating:
none, rated G
Word Count: 100
Summary: Jack makes a new friend after a bar fight gets out of hand.
Author's Note: Written for [community profile] tw100's crossovers challenge

“Thanks for the help.” Jack said, slapping his savior on the back.  “Have you ever seen a bar fight get out of hand so quickly?”  His new friend just shrugged.  “Well, I have to admit, it could have gotten pretty ugly for me if you hadn’t stepped in.  That is one mean punch you got.   How ‘bout I buy you a drink?  Just as a little way of showing my appreciation, of course.”  Seeing the smile he called the barkeep over, “Bring one of your finest drinks for my friend here.”

“Oook.” 

“And a banana.” 

“Oook.”

“Make that two bananas.”
